The ability to remove limiters placed on a person in order to release their full potential. Opposite to Limitation Inducement.

Also Called

  • Limit Release
  • Suppressor Removal

Capabilities

User can release/remove the limiters that are usually placed onto the body and abilities in order to prevent them from suffering the strain of their full power, or to protect the surrounding area from the destructive potential. By disabling these suppressors, the user can gain access to this full potential.

Restraints can range from taking off heavy weights or other such limiters worn on the body to forcefully disabling the body's subconscious of holding back.

Limitations

  • May only be able to affect oneself or others.
  • Once removed, it may be difficult, if not impossible, to reactivate the limiter.
  • Prolonged release may cause strain and other side effects to the user.
